Transaction 25d66782586599ea0c9d11453ffdcb8394056bb65c842050f7f21a8332181f2c
1 Input
1 Output
-
25d66782586599ea0c9d11453ffdcb8394056bb65c842050f7f21a8332181f2c:0
- value
- 16031327
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26cb0455deae70d415ee2ff8883776dbb78314ef OP_EQUALVERIFY OP_CHECKSIG
- address
- 14Y7t9uQpZZNWCQKKmbTn7zfh6QSeZE58m